Rahm lays off 625 union workers

Where are the protests? Chicago Mayor Rahm Emanuel announced the layoffs of 625 union workers earlier today, many of them custodial workers at libraries and the the city's two airports. Private firms will do the tidying up instead.

The Chicago Federation of Labor was warned this would happen--unless it agreed to work rule reforms.
